How much below market value do cash buyers actually pay?
A direct buyer works backward from the repaired value and subtracts repairs, cleanout, holding costs, closing costs and profit. The gap is wide on a house that needs a roof, AC, plumbing and a full cleanout, and narrow on an updated house — which is why an updated house usually belongs on the open market.
The honest framing is not 'market value versus cash offer.' It is net-in-your-pocket versus net-in-your-pocket. A listing price is a gross number before commissions, repair credits after inspection, concessions, months of carrying costs, and the risk the buyer's financing falls through.
On a house needing significant work, those deductions frequently close most of the gap. On an updated house in a financeable building or neighborhood, they do not, and a listing wins.
Ask any buyer to show you the arithmetic behind their number. If they will not, that tells you something.
